The depth of Oregon's addiction epidemic

As the COVID pandemic loses some of its punch, at least for now, attention turns to another ongoing health crisis: addiction. Alcohol, opioids, and street drugs are all being abused at high rates across the country.

Oregon is having issues getting a handle on the situation, ranking high in addiction rates and low in providing access to addiction treatment. The difficulties have been noticed by Oregon Recovers, a statewide coalition, and Reclaiming Lives/Recovery Café based in Medford.

Mike Marshall of OR and Stephanie Mendenhall of RL/RC guide us through a conversation about what needs to be done to better address addiction and its impacts.
